Wilfried Martens listen  (born 19 April 1936) is a Belgian politician. He was born in Sleidinge (East Flanders). Martens has been prime minister nine times: four times from 3 April 1979 to 6 April 1981 and five times from 17 December 1981 to 7 March 1992. He has chaired the European People's Party since 1992. He is a member of the Christian Democrat centrist party CD&V.

Martens has five children: two from his first marriage with Lieve Verschroeven and three with Ilse Schouteden who he met in 1988 while she was an assistant working in his cabinet. After the birth of their twins in 1997 they married on November 13, 1998. Ilse Schouteden has a son from her previous marriage.
